On August 15, 2025,
(ASTS) closed with a 0.87% decline, trading at a volume of $220 million, a 62.22% drop from the previous day’s activity. The stock ranked 461st in trading volume among listed equities. Recent market activity reflected mixed signals as the company navigated earnings pressures and strategic developments.Analyst activity highlighted both optimism and caution. Roth Capital raised its price target and reaffirmed a “Buy” rating, citing progress toward deploying up to 60 satellites and growing service demand. Meanwhile, earnings results revealed a wider-than-expected Q2 loss and revenue shortfall, with EPS at ($0.41) compared to ($0.19) consensus. The company outlined plans to launch 45–60 fully funded satellites by year-end, aiming to establish intermittent U.S. service by late 2025.
Investor sentiment was further shaped by institutional activity, including new positions and increased holdings from entities like
LLC and IPG Investment Advisors. Despite these developments, near-term volatility persisted due to elevated operating costs and macroeconomic headwinds.
